
Sturgis Rally is largest attraction in the state for sex traffickers
This year’s Sturgis Motorcycle Rally is scheduled to take place August 3-12. With hundreds of thousands of visitors attending, it will become the largest city in South Dakota during those ten days. Many tourists flock to the area because of the motorcycles, concerts, and other scheduled events. Vendors descend on the town to sell food, t-shirts, Harley gear, and all kinds of rally souvenirs. Some of the vendors and tourists, however, are engaged in a much more nefarious tourist business: the Sturgis rally is the largest attraction in South Dakota for sex traffickers.
South Dakota is a hot spot for men coming to the state for hunting, the Sturgis Bike Rally, and other tourism events and destinations. Marty Jackley, South Dakota Attorney General, stated, “Whenever you have a large group of people that come together, such as the Sturgis Motorcycle Rally, there’s always a handful of bad.” Law enforcement agencies run human trafficking operations during these times, putting out advertisements pretending to sell young children. And shockingly, hundreds of people respond. Last year was the fifth year undercover sex sting operations have taken plac at the Sturgis Rally
